I compared the tcpdump of the logon sequence to jabber server via cicq and
via gaim. The problem with cicq is in requesting "Agent list" feature.
I tried to compile cicq from 20060929 witch applied patch sent by Magnus
Henoch but I'm still failing with error:

configure: error: conditional "am__fastdepCXX" was never defined.
Usually this means the macro was only invoked conditionally.
configure: error: ./configure failed for firetalk

Hints from google are not working. Do you have some idea?
